Bentley key not recognised

I hope all you clever folks can help me with this. About a year ago I had the dealer install a new battery in the key of my wife's 2013 GT. Everything was fine until recently. The car would give a message that it did not recognized the key. If I pressed the lock and unlock button on the key then it worked. and recognized te key. Now suddenly not even pressing te button is working. It just says key not found.

Are you referring to the House Battery or the key battery? The key in my 2005 warns me with a "Low Key Battery" message. It is important to replace the batteries in BOTH keys when you change them. Low car batteries will generally put a red battery light alert on your speedometer screen.
